EnochLight;212525 Wrote: 
> I've tried default and "Touch".  Both work fine, but "Touch" is a little
> weird - can't scroll all the way down my playlist for some reason. 
> Default works fine though, you just have to zoom in to select the links
> accurately.
> 
> The iPhone is actually quite brilliant in the way that it handles WiFi
> - it's off when you are out of range, but as soon as you get within an
> approved WiFi signal (or freebie that doesn't require a WEP), it
> hitches on.  If there is a WEP key needed, you can set it up and then
> it will hitch on automatically when in range.  Walk out of range and it
> switches to Edge.
> 
> It's a very handy Squeezebox remote, though not a sole purpose for
> buying an iPhone.  That said, the iPhone is probably the best gadget I
> have bought since my Squeezebox!
> 
> ;-)
Great info, thanks for the post.  You might want to try the Nokia770
skin to see if it works better, although these days the Touch and 770
skin look quite alike and I'm not sure what's even different other than
maybe some spacing.
